The boss of the group Volkswagen, Martin Winterkorn, has indeed confirmed to journalists of the British magazine Autocar that Porsche would have a new entry model range, "a descendant of the famous 356", built on the same basis as the Future Audi R4, seen as a concept car at the recent Detroit Auto Show.

Coach provides a rate of around 40000 euros for the future baby Porsche should have about 250 hp. As for a possible cannibalization of the range Boxster / Cayman, Porsche had already thought of everything: the next generation will rise in line
